titleOfInvention |
Touch panel, radiation-sensitive resin composition and cured film |
abstract |
Provided is a highly reliable touch panel having a metal wiring line and a cured film covering the metal wiring line. Also provided are the cured film and a radiation-sensitive resin composition for forming the cured film.nA radiation-sensitive resin composition for forming a cured film (25) of a touch panel (21) is prepared so as to contain (A) a sensitizing agent and (B) an alkoxy silyl group-containing compound and/or a hydrolysis-condensation product of the compound. A touch panel (21) is provided by forming a cured film (25), with use of this radiation-sensitive resin composition, on a transparent substrate (22) on which a first detection electrode (23), a second detection electrode (24) and a wiring line (31) having a first layer containing copper and a second layer that is configured to cover at least a part of the first layer and to contain an oxide of a second metal element other than copper are arranged. |
